Strike at Isfahan Steel Plant

The Free Workers Union announced on Monday, February 26th, through their Telegram channel, that hundreds of police and special forces personnel were present at the Isfahan Steel Plant complex. They were attempting to intensify the atmosphere of fear and terror among the protesting workers with a motorcade procession. According to this labor media outlet, the presence of these forces also involved the arrest of several protesters. The workers at the Isfahan Steel Plant gathered in protest on the 6th and 7th of February, due to the non-fulfillment of their financial promises and demands, within the premises of this complex.
